Apparently Rob Zombie’s out in the limelight again discussing his upcoming CD, Educated Horses with LA DJs Kevin & Bean, as well as more cool stuff he has coming up…
Over on About Horror, Staci Wilson took the time to transcribe a piece of the chat Zombie had with the morning guys, discussing a film we’ve not heard anything about in a long time; the animated Haunted World of El Superbeasto. “It’s a beautiful-looking movie,” he told them. “All these animators from studios like Disney came to work on it, and [they’re thrilled because] they get to work on something filthy. Its probably rated XXX now, but we’ll have to cut it back to an R.”
As you may be aware, El Superbeasto is based on the characters created for Zombie’s short-lived Spookshow International comic series. Zombie said he’d always planned on making it animated at first, then going back an considering a live-action approach. “Now, seeing it animated, you can’t do these things physically,” He admitted.
Zombie also said he’s working on a few different movie projects now, and that me may jump right into directing when his Horses tour is up.
